An update from Collective Mining ( (TSE:CNL) ) is now available.
Collective Mining reported new assay results from four diamond drill holes at the Apollo system within its Guayabales Project in Colombia, confirming high-grade, near-surface mineralization in gold, tungsten, silver and copper, including standout intercepts such as 111.15 metres at 5.48 g/t gold equivalent from just 2 metres depth. The company said these holes returned higher gold and tungsten grades than those in its internal block model, improving local grades by up to 25%, closing drilling gaps at shallow depths and reinforcing Apollo’s status as a large, vertically continuous, multi-metal discovery that could positively influence a planned maiden mineral resource estimate and support its strategy of aggressive expansion drilling funded by a strong cash position.

More about Collective Mining
Collective Mining Ltd. is a Toronto-listed exploration company focused on advancing its flagship Guayabales Project, a district-scale, multi-target mineral property in Caldas, Colombia. The company explores for a suite of metals including gold, tungsten, silver and copper, with the Apollo system serving as its primary discovery and anchor asset within the project, supported by extensive diamond drilling and strong cash reserves to fund aggressive exploration programs.
